Atrium Health is a non-profit health system head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, and founded in 1940 as Charlotte Memorial Hospital. The system runs dozens of hospitals and hundreds of care locations across the Carolinas, Georgia, and Alabama, along with the Wake Forest University School of Medicine and Levine Children's Hospital. It became part of Advocate Health in a 2022 combination, forming one of the largest non-profit health systems in the United States.

Atrium Health Navicent is recruiting a Nurse Practicioner to join Atrium Health Navicent Cardiology team in Macon, Georgia. We are looking for an APP motivated to meet the highest standards of care and to partner in providing the best in evidence-based care in a premier and highly respected environment. We are seeking candidates who are forward-thinking with a dedication to excellence. Opportunity to work a mix between clinic and the hospital.

Atrium Health Navicent is a part of the Advocate Health family, with a combined footprint across 6 states and is the 3rd largest non-profit with 67 hospitals. Advocate Health is working to advance health equity and improve access and affordability for the people and communities we serve. Atrium Health Navicent The Medical Center, as the second largest hospital in Georgia, is a 637-bed American College of Surgeons verified level one trauma center and is the teaching program for Mercer University School of Medicine. Proudly boasts an STS 3-star Heart and Vascular Center which houses cardiac catheterization labs, dedicated state of the art operating rooms, hybrid OR Cath lab, EP lab, CVICU, and a cardiac rehabilitation center; all staffed by a dedicated team of highly skilled APPs, nurses, and support personal.

For Nurse Practitioners:

  • Education: Must be a graduate of an accredited Nurse Practitioner program with a Master Degree in Nursing.
  • Certification/License/Registration: Must maintain a current RN and APRN license to practice in the State of Georgia.
  • Special Training/Skills: Must demonstrate competence in their practice setting and must be able to perform with a high degree of accuracy to reduce errors in judgment related to care of patients. Must obtain required CEU's in care of patients in the care setting each renewal period. Must maintain a high degree of confidentiality. Must be able to work irregular schedules dependent upon needs of patients.

About Advocate Health

Advocate Health is the third-largest nonprofit, integrated health system in the United States, created from the combination of Advocate Aurora Health and Atrium Health. Providing care under the names Advocate Health Care in Illinois; Atrium Health in the Carolinas, Georgia and Alabama; and Aurora Health Care in Wisconsin, Advocate Health is a national leader in clinical innovation, health outcomes, consumer experience and value-based care.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Advocate Health services nearly 6 million patients and is engaged in hundreds of clinical trials and research studies, with Wake Forest University School of Medicine serving as the academic core of the enterprise. It is nationally recognized for its expertise in cardiology, neurosciences, oncology, pediatrics and rehabilitation, as well as organ transplants, burn treatments and specialized musculoskeletal programs. Advocate Health employs 155,000 teammates across 69 hospitals and over 1,000 care locations, and offers one of the nation’s largest graduate medical education programs with over 2,000 residents and fellows across more than 200 programs. Committed to providing equitable care for all, Advocate Health provides more than $6 billion in annual community benefits.
